Our Guiding Spiritual Practices
Our Guiding Practices are the spiritual practices and consciousness-elevating techniques which allow us to live from our inner being of Divine wholeness and to be a beneficial presence in the world.

The five fundamental practices include prayer (spiritual mind treatment/affirmative and devotional), meditation, spiritual education, the principle and practice of financial circulation, and selfless service.
Prayer – Spiritual Mind Treatment is the affirmative prayer we use to commune with the Eternal Presence which consists of 5 steps including: Recognition, Unification, Realization, Thanksgiving, and Release. The simplest prayer is there is only one God, I am one with it now, it is a perfect life, and all is well, I give thanks as I release it to the creative action of the law where it is made manifest now. And so it is! Devotional prayer is more personal and communion with the God/Spirit/Source Energy/Presence of your understanding in any way that is comfortable for you, without any formula and a free flow of or stream of consciousness from the heart.
Meditation – Meditation can take many forms such as silent sitting, chanting, movement (walking, yoga, dancing, etc.), drawing mandalas, etc. When we meditate, we allow ourselves to slow down and give the mind a rest from thought and doing, moving into a state of being. Centered and anchored we emerge with new energy, clarity, and vitality of Spirit.
Spiritual Education – This is ongoing and can include taking a class or workshop, daily readings from a spiritual book of your choice, attending a Sunday service or a lecture, and so on. We encourage learning more about the philosophy of Ernest Holmes by reading How to Change Your Life: An Inspirational Life-Changing Classic, Basic Ideas of Science of Mind, the Science of Mind textbook, other Ernest Holmes writings, or perhaps reading the daily guides from the Science of Mind Magazine.
Financial Circulation – We practice giving to our spiritual community where we are nourished and fed spiritually out of the generosity of the Spirit within us in a regular fashion. As we do this, we strengthen our trust in the Spirit knowing that as we give, we also receive, and the giving enhances the value of our community. Our gifts return to us multiplied abundantly.
Selfless Service – We participate in selflessly serving our spiritual community in any way that we can, based on our talent and devotion. It takes a village for any community to thrive and as each individual contributes from their heart there is growth and beauty that emerges.
